// Relevance tuning for the Hobbleford search stack, written up so support
// can sanity-check "why is X ranking above Y" tickets without paging us.
// Short version: title matches beat description matches, recency gets a
// gentle boost, and exact SKU hits skip scoring entirely. If a customer
// complaint looks like a weighting issue, compare against the values in
// this module first. The current knobs are set as follows.

tuning table, yajog-yahof:
BUDGETS = {
    "lamvan": 303,
    "wenox": 460,
    "fenvan": 525,
}

## Deployment

Paritype checks hotel rate parity across channels on a five-minute cycle. Deploy as a single container per region; it is stateless except for a local result cache. Reviewers: confirm the scraper pool size matches the region's channel count, and that alert thresholds were not copied blindly from the sandbox manifest. Rolling restarts are safe; the scheduler resumes from the last completed sweep. The deployment expects the following configuration values.

settings of tagef-bawif:
DRUIX_HOST=druix.zemvarlabs.internal
DRUIX_PORT=8000

## Runbook: Thornbury Component Library Versioning

All apps pin an exact version of the Thornbury shared library. Never use ranges. Minor bumps require a visual regression pass in the Saltmere preview environment; majors require sign-off from the platform rotation. If a consumer breaks after an upgrade, roll the pin back first, investigate second. To confirm which library build a deployed app is actually serving, check its footer metadata, which prints the token shown below.

trace token, kahog-tajeg: htk6_97d963